ysql数据库中同步指定表的数据。下面我们将介绍如何实现数据的完全同步。
步骤一:创建目标表
首先,我们需要在目标数据库中创建一个与源数据库中要同步的表结构相同的目标表。我们可以通过以下语句来创建目标表:
CREATE TABLE target_table LIKE source_table;
其中,target_table和source_table分别代表目标表和源表。
步骤二:备份数据
接下来,我们需要备份源表的数据。我们可以通过以下语句来备份数据:
INSERT INTO target_table SELECT * FROM source_table;
这个语句会将源表中的所有数据插入到目标表中。
步骤三:设置定时任务
为了实现数据的实时同步,我们需要设置一个定时任务来定期执行同步操作。我们可以通过以下语句来创建一个每分钟执行一次的定时任务:
c_table
ON SCHEDULE EVERY 1 MINUTE
INSERT INTO target_table SELECT * FROM source_table;
c_table代表定时任务的名称,1 MINUTE表示每分钟执行一次,INSERT INTO target_table SELECT * FROM source_table;表示要执行的同步操作。
ysql数据库中同步指定表的数据。需要注意的是,如果源表中的数据发生了变化,需要及时执行同步操作以保证数据的实时同步。